Propeller gearbox disassembly
See Figs. 72-25, 72-26 and 72-27.
■ CAUTION : Only push the dog gear down until it is possible to
remove the two ring halves, otherwise the gearbox
housing could be destroyed. The gear cover should be
rotated back and forth during this step!
Place the complete gearbox in a suitable fixture (1) and press down the
gear wheel with the mounting yoke (2), part no. 876885, until the ring
halves (3) can be removed, see 00-00-00 section 10.4
Now relieve the pressure on the gear by turning spindle (4) back and
remove the mounting yoke and the gearbox from the fixture. Remove
the drive gear (5), the thrust washer and the dog gear. Force bearing
bushing (6) apart with circlip pliers and withdraw from the propeller
shaft.
■ CAUTION: Do not overstress bearing bushing (6), as otherwise it
will become unusable.
Remove the complete overload clutch (7) or dog hub (13), disc springs
(8) 80x35x3, step collar (9), 6 mm (0.236 in.) distance sleeve (17),
compensating shim (10), eccenter (11) (for fuel pump on the ROTAX
912 Series, of no significance on the 914 Series) and 8 mm (0.31in.)
distance sleeve (12).
■ CAUTION: The overload clutch is fitted in serial production on all
certified aircraft engines and on all noncertified aircraft
engines of configuration 3. All other engine versions
are equipped with a dog hub, but available with an
optional overload clutch or can be retrofitted to accom-
modate one.
